Kedar Murthy is currently the Vice President and General Manager of Lehigh Technologies Tire and Industrial Rubber Business. Mr. Murthy has over 20 years of experience in developing business strategy, managing sales teams, marketing, operations and finances in the global chemical's industry. He has experience in managing both specialty and commodity chemicals businesses. Kedar led several startups within large corporations and established joint ventures in India, Brazil, and Russia. Previously he was EVP Global OEM Business at GPX International Tire, and held several senior leadership positions at Cabot Corporation including Director of Global Sales, Marketing and Technical Services for all Specialty Chemicals Businesses and the Corporate e-Business Group. At General Electric he was Marketing Person of the Year and earned his Six Sigma Black Belt while on Corporate Audit Staff.

He is the Marketing Chair for TiE-Boston (The Indus Entrepreneurs) and served as Chair TiECON East 2009, the East Coast's largest Entreprenueurial Conference. He has both a B.S. and M.S. degrees in Chemical Engineering from Rose-Hulman Institute of Technology and The University of Wisconsin-Madison respectively.
